Output 7643d6e2575fc4322078fbe6138e7dd639ca9d3a7fbf3b80e058af4e7ad6974b:4

value
26635550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a66ca07fa20087faa55ecb356d916397a1796fc0 OP_EQUAL
address
MP58XojtPiRcrEoQD2UvDXuUSbwGE7BWuk
transaction
7643d6e2575fc4322078fbe6138e7dd639ca9d3a7fbf3b80e058af4e7ad6974b
spent
true